A few more BIG boats found in the North Sound, a popular anchorage in the BVI.
1 & 2) - Cakewalk ( A great article on Cakewalk starting on page 70 of June 2011 edition of Yachting magazine. One of the largest US built mega yachts ever. L = 281' ; Beam = 46' 9" ; Draft = 13' 1" etc ) 3)- Windship 4) - White Cloud 5) - VF - 15 |
